Epigenetic Programming of Hypoxic-Ischemic Encephalopathy in Response to Fetal Hypoxia
Hypoxia is a major stress to the fetal development and may result in irreversible injury in the developing brain, increased risk of central nervous system (CNS) malformations in the neonatal brain and long-term neurological complications in offspring.
